Subject: Ownership change — string extraction script

All — as part of the Norwick tooling reshuffle, responsibility for the translation-string extraction script (the one that scans templates and emits the locale catalog) is moving to a new maintainer. The script's quirks are documented in the i18n handbook, including the known issue with nested pluralization blocks. Please hold non-urgent change requests until next sprint. Effective immediately, all reviews and release tags go through the maintainer named below.

named custodian: Gilael Julwyn Ulaok Sormir

Handover note — Crumbwheel order cutoffs.

Welcome aboard. The bakery cutoff rule in Crumbwheel closes same-day orders at 14:00 local to each storefront, not UTC — this has bitten us twice. Holiday overrides live in the calendar service and take precedence silently, so always check there first when a cutoff looks wrong. To unlock the calendar service's admin console after a restart, enter the recovery passphrase below.

vault phrase of bagap-bahaf = silion-pelox-sorox-casdor-quenwyn-fraax-eliox-praael-kelion-quenvan-kasox-rusael-norius-belvan

## Migrating Cron Jobs to Flowstitch

Plugin authors: all scheduled tasks formerly run via cron on the Bramblehost boxes are moving to the Flowstitch workflow engine. Your plugin's schedule definition now lives in a `flow.toml` file, and retries, backoff, and logging are handled by the engine. Local testing requires the Flowstitch emulator, which talks to our internal registry service. To authenticate the emulator during development, use the key below.

service key, tahaf-yaduf: qvz11-icGvt2med8u

Onboarding — PickPath Optimizer, vault access

New team members: the PickPath optimizer keeps its routing model encrypted at rest in the Fennick warehouse cluster. On first setup, your workstation must decrypt a local replica before the test suite will pass. Run `pickpath init`, confirm the fingerprint it prints matches the wiki, and wait for the prompt. At that prompt, enter the recovery passphrase shown immediately below.

recovery phrase for fawif-tajeg: norael-aldmir-casir-brivan-ulaion